An unemployed man from Terengganu has been sentenced to eight years in prison and given two whipping strokes by the Sessions Court here on Tuesday for robbing RM70 from a senior citizen, causing injuries to the victim, back in April.

Budiyono Udin, 35, from Kampung Binjai Bongkok, Bukit Payong, Marang pleaded guilty to the charges of 
robbery and intentionally causing injury to the victim, Ngah Taib, 79, as well as taking RM70 cash belonging to the victim.

On the day of the incident at about 9:30 AM on April 24th, the accused came to the victim's house yard and demanded money, and proceeded to snatch some cash from the victim's left shirt pocket.

Then, the accused took the floorboard that was on the drain on the sidewalk of the victim's house before hitting the victim on the left shoulder, causing him to fall. He even attempted to take the machete the victim was holding but failed.


The victim then quickly rushed to the nearest police station to lodge a report.
